The India Meteorological Department has warned of rainfall in Assam this winter

Rainfall is expected in Assam this winter, according to a warning from the India Meteorological Department (IMD). Ten regions are predicted to be affected by the rain, which might cause disruptions to daily life. Nagaon, Karbi Anglong, Hojai, Sribhumi, Hailakandi, Dhubri, Goalpara, Bongaigaon, Kokrajhar, and South Salmara are among the districts that would be impacted. The IMD predicts that rain will start to fall today, which will likely affect these areas. The temperature will briefly dip, as is usual in winter, but the rain could cause issues, especially in low-lying and flood-prone places.

In the meantime, Assam Police created an educational video earlier this month that emphasized the need of road safety in light of the festive picnic season and the challenges posed by winter fog. The advise emphasized important safety precautions for driving in inclement weather and for leisure trips. In order to keep everyone safe during the outings, travelers were urged to make sure that the driving duty was delegated to a sober person.

Weather-based travel planning was also urged, with a strong warning against going when it was foggy or raining a lot. To lessen the risks associated with poor visibility, the police had also suggested that travel be limited to daytime hours, starting after sunrise and ending before dusk.
